What are the responsibilities and job description for the President - Action Air Systems, LLC position at Action Air Systems, LLC?
Description
The President of Action Air Systems, LLC is responsible for the overall leadership, strategic direction, and financial performance of Action Air Systems, operating along with the partnership of the NexCore organization. This executive role provides comprehensive oversight of daily operations while ensuring alignment with NexCore’s corporate objectives, governance standards, and growth initiatives.
The President will drive sustainable profitability, operational excellence, and organizational development while maintaining a strong focus on safety, quality, customer satisfaction, and regulatory compliance.

Qualifications/Education Required Skills & Abilities
Required Skills/Abilities:
- Extensive leadership experience in operations, preferably within HVAC, construction, or manufacturing industries.
- Proven ability to manage budgets and drive financial results.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
- Excellent interpersonal and conflict resolution skills.
- Excellent organizational skills and attention to detail.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
- Strong supervisory and leadership skills.
- Proficient with Microsoft Office 365 or related software.
Education and Experience:
-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Construction Management, Engineering, or a related field required; MBA or advanced degree preferred.
- Minimum of ten (10) years of progressive executive leadership experience within the HVAC, mechanical contracting, or construction industry.
- State of CT S1 Department of Consumer Protection Licensure is a plus.
- Demonstrated success managing full P&L responsibility and driving sustained profitable growth.
- Extensive knowledge of construction operations, project management, estimating, and safety compliance.
- Strong strategic planning, financial analysis, and organizational leadership capabilities.
- Experience working within a parent company, private equity, or multi-entity corporate structure preferred.
